CHESTER, Pa. –
Martin Bohdan and
Aaron Green each won three races and a relay victory as the Pride swept a pair of meets on Saturday afternoon, downing Hood 204-50 and Messiah 178-80.
Bohdan did all of his damage in freestyle events. He started his afternoon by claiming the 200 yard event in 1:46.54 before taking the 100 in 48.99. Shifting to distance, he won 500 free in 4:58.80 before leading the winning 400 free relay squad where he was joined by
Tim Dando,
Sam Smith, and Green in clocking in at 3:17.23.
Green took the top spot in the 100 backstroke, touching the wall in 53.76. He then sprinted his way to the 50 free victory in 21.47 before winning the 100 fly in 52.78, more than three seconds faster than his nearest competitor. Finishing his day, Green made up a gap of nearly 2.5 seconds in the anchor leg for Widener win in the 400 free relay.
Paolo Cortez contributed with a pair of wins, taking the 100 breaststroke and 200 IM in 1:01.89 and 2:08.18 respectively.
Chris Fleming won the 200 fly in 2:04.80.
John Porter Luksic took the top spot in the 200 breaststroke with a time of 2:17.13.
